Independent singer/songwriter whose 2015 self-titled debut album peaked at #30 on the iTunes charts. He also released the EP American Rose in 2015. His debut single "California" was featured by Perez Hilton.
He graduated from Slippery Rock University in 2012 with a bachelor's degree in art. He was also assistant captain on the Ice Hockey team for four years. He started posting covers on YouTube his junior year. His rendition of Boyfriend" garnered around 200,000 views over night.
He had a role as an extra in the 2014 film Foxcatcher. He shares short clips of his songs on his Instagram, which has earned more than 20,000 followers.
He comes from a hard working American family of general contractors who build homes and develop land outside of Pittsburgh. He has two older sisters, a niece named Emmarie and a nephew named Declan.
He spent time in Texas writing and recording with Emily Robison of the Dixie Chicks and Martin Strayer of Court Yard Hounds.
